Day 22: Split Marina and Ivan Mestrovic

Today was our last full day in Split.  We headed west walking toward the Marina.  It was a nice walk along the sea.



We walked further to the Gallerie Ivan Mestrovic.  He is probably the most famous artist in Croatia.  He is known for his marble, bronze, and wood sculptures.  We visited his summer home, which has been turned into a museum.







We then had lunch on a hill overlooking the marina and city.  It was pretty spectacular.



While eating we watched this sailing ship raise its sails and move out of the harbor.



I will miss Split.  We had a very pleasant stay.
